Expert Review
This role at Six Flags Fiesta Texas offers work in a vibrant environment. With the park's focus on guest experience, teamwork is essential, and employees must be adaptable to various tasks. The job demands standing and moving throughout shifts, which can be a drawback for some.
While the position is part-time and flexible, expect busy periods that require a high level of energy and customer service skills. It's a great way to gain experience in the food and beverage industry, but you should be ready for the hectic pace during peak times, especially on weekends and holidays. Customer feedback indicates a supportive team atmosphere, but the physical demands can be taxing.
